Read MoreThe German post office is likely to apply for a licence to collect business mail in the UK following the publication of plans to open the market to competition.
Deutsche Post is the largest in a group of postal and distribution companies thought to be queueing to enter previously closed parts of the UK market now that the regulator, Postcomm, is to end the postal delivery monopoly held by Consignia, formerly the Post Office.
Germany’s Regulatory Agency for Telecommunication and Posts (RTP) plans to introduce a new price-capping procedure to address concerns about the pricing policy of postal services group Deutsche Post AG, Handelsblatt has learned.
RTP vice-president Gerhard Harms said the details of the procedure, the conditions that must be followed, will be decided shortly. The approval for current prices runs out at the end of 2002.
Lazard, the investment bank, has been hired by the government to advise on the restructuring of Consignia, the renamed Post Office. The bank’s mandate is to review the restructuring plan put forward by Consignia’s board. It will also advise the government on companies that bid to take over parts of the post-office operation.
